[173], According to the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ey data estimates for 20082012, the median income for a household in the city was $47,408, and the median income for a family was $54,188. [287] In 2013, the violent crime rate was 910 per 100,000 people;[289] the murder rate was 10.4 while high crime districts saw 38.9, low crime districts saw 2.5 murders per 100,000. [344] As of 2002[update], severe freight train congestion caused trains to take as long to get through the Chicago region as it took to get there from the West Coast of the country (about 2 days). [345] According to U.S. Department of Transportation, the volume of imported and exported goods transported via rail to, from, or through Chicago is forecast to increase nearly 150 percent between 2010 and 2040. As new additions to the city were platted, city ordinance required them to be laid out with eight streets to the mile in one direction and sixteen in the other direction (about one street per 200 meters in one direction and one street per 100 meters in the other direction).
